面向QoS预测的位置最近邻矩阵分解算法研究
Research on Location Nearest Neighborhood-integrated Matrix Factorization for Web Service QoS Prediction
【摘要】 为改善Web服务QoS预测效率,向用户提供高质量的Web服务,提出一种融合位置最近邻法则的扩展矩阵分解算法.该方法首先利用用户和服务的位置信息进行用户和服务的最近邻选择,克服了传统的QoS预测算法对Web服务位置信息利用不准确或不足的问题.然后将邻域信息融入矩阵分解框架,改善了矩阵分解技术在QoS预测中本地信息利用不足的问题,同时采用梯度下降算法进行QoS的预测.最后,本文基于真实Web服务数据集WSRec进行了对比实验,实验结果表明了本文所提算法的有效性.
【Abstract】 To improve the efficiency of Web service QoS prediction,providing users with high-quality Web services,a collaborative filtering method fused matrix factorization and nearest neighbor rule is proposed. Firstly,this method uses the location information of users and services to select neighborhoods of user and service,to overcome the inaccurate or insufficient use of location information in traditional QoS prediction algorithms. Then the neighborhood information is combined into the matrix factorization framework to improve the lack use of local information in matrix factorization technique,and gradient descent algorithm is used for QoS prediction. Finally,based on real Web service dataset WSRec,we conducted experiments compared with other algorithms and the experimental results validate the approach.
【Key words】 web service; QoS prediction; matrix factorization; neighborhood-based;
